Introducing Our New Conference Organiser

Hello everyone. This is just a short post to introduce myself and let every know I will be the new organiser of this site and the conference.

Firstly, a huge thank you to Todd for starting and running this community since it began in 2014. That work, the events, the conversations, the games, and the stubborn persistence is the reason we have this forum for professional wargaming in Australia.

For those interested, my background in wargaming comes primarily from my work with Defence, and I currently co-teach a professional wargaming course. While I am familiar with analytical wargaming, most of my experience and interest lies in the educational application of wargames. Along the way I have designed a number of games, and with the help of some excellent colleagues one of these has been commercially published

So what happens now?

The conference and this blog will continue. I can’t promise the next event will be exactly the same format as past years, but the aim is unchanged: build a professional space for educators, practitioners, academics, and hobbyists to share methods, run demos, and grow Australia’s wargaming capability.

Connections Oz Conference 2025

The Connections Oz conference will be held online again this year, commencing Wed 12 November and ending Thu 13 November.

Please consider this a call for presentations and/or ideas.

There is no specific theme other than an opportunity to showcase local wargame related projects and some selected international speakers.
